  			 				When I won my appeal yesterday I made sure I was clean and tidy and well dressed, just the same as I always do.
 
I wouldn't have felt comfortable looking tatty and with no make up on and I think it would have shown that my untidy appearance was contrived which may have affected how the panel perceived my honesty.
 
I'm not saying not to dress down if you think it's to your advantage but for me just being naturally myself felt better for me.
 
I had to go through some very embarrassing questions but the panel drew responses out of me and actualy listened to what I had to say whereas at my medical the barriers were up straight away and the HCP was the last person I wanted to confide in.
